07 Oct 2009 xml Charge Coupled Device (CCD)
Willard S. Boyle and George E. Smith were awarded the 2009 Nobel Prize in Physics for their invention and development of the charge coupled device (CCD), a technology that transforms patterns of light into useful digital information. CCD technology is the basis for many forms of modern imaging, and is widely used in devices as diverse as digital cameras, video cameras, cell phones, PDAs and bar code readers as well as in security monitoring, medical endoscopy, modern astronomy and video conferencing.
